> So, the struct adjtimex freq field takes a signed value who's
> units are in shifted (<<16) parts-per-million.
> 
> Unfortunately for negative adjustments, the straightforward use
> of:
>       freq = ppm<<16
> will trip undefined behavior warnings with clang:
> 
> valid-adjtimex.c:66:6: warning: shifting a negative signed value is undefined 
> [-Wshift-negative-value]
>         -499<<16,
>         ~~~~^
> valid-adjtimex.c:67:6: warning: shifting a negative signed value is undefined 
> [-Wshift-negative-value]
>         -450<<16,
>         ~~~~^
> ...
> 
> So fix our use of shifting negative values in the valid-adjtimex
> test case to use multiply by (1<<16) to avoid this.
> 
> The patch also aligns the values a bit to make it look nicer.
